

The Good Companions Seniors' Centre is a vibrant community hub in Ottawa offering a wide range of social, recreational, and health services tailored for seniors and adults with physical disabilities. With over 100 programs, the centre fosters social integration, affordability, and accessibility.
The Good Companions is a non-profit multi-service seniors’ centre dedicated to promoting the well-being and independence of seniors and adults with physical disabilities in the greater Ottawa area. Through a variety of programs and services, the centre provides a stimulating and supportive environment where older adults can engage in social, recreational, educational, and volunteer activities. The centre also offers community support services such as transportation, grocery delivery, and home maintenance, ensuring comprehensive care for its members.
